4-12 Troubleshooting and Repair
DISASSEMBLY AND REASSEMBLY
This subsection contains step-by-step disassembly procedures for the system. Reassembly is
the reverse of disassembly. Each procedure is supported by a simplified disassembly illus-
tration to facilitate removal. The detailed exploded-view diagram and parts lists for the sys-
tem unit are shown later in this subsection.
Required tools include a Phillips-head screwdriver. For complete disassembly of the system
unit, follow the disassembly order listed in Table Section 4-5 to reassemble, follow the table
in reverse order.
Table Section 4-5 Versa P Series Disassembly Sequence
Sequence
Part
See Page
1
Primary Battery Pack (NiMH Battery)
4-13
2
Memory Card
4-14
3
Hard Disk Drive
4-15
4
LCD
4-17
5
Top Cover
4-19
6
Keyboard
4-19
7
LCD Indicator Panel
4-21
8
Diskette Drive
4-22
9
CMOS Battery
4-24
10
CPU Board
4-25
11
Bridge Battery
4-26
12
VersaTrack Assembly
4-27
13
System Board
4-28
When disassembling the system unit, follow these general rules.
n
Turn off and disconnect all power and all options, including the AC adapter (if
connected) and primary battery pack (see the procedures that follow).
n
Do not disassemble the system into parts that are smaller than those specified in
the procedure.
n
Label all removed connectors. Note where the connector goes and in what posi-
tion it was installed.
